Mix the flour, sesame seeds, salt, baking soda, and yeast together in a big bowl. Toss in the scallions and stir well. Pour in the melted butter and milk that’s at room temp. Stir until it pulls together, then knead it briefly until smooth. Set it aside to chill for 15 minutes.
02 -
Turn on your oven to 375°F (190°C) so it heats up. Cut the dough into two halves and line your counter with a sheet of parchment paper. Coat your rolling pin lightly with oil so the dough doesn’t stick.
03 -
Flatten one half of the dough on the parchment paper until it’s super thin—aim for about 2 millimeters (like a coin). Grab a small round cutter or even the rim of a glass to punch out little cracker shapes.
04 -
Move your freshly cut crackers onto a baking tray. Take a fork and gently poke holes in them; this keeps them from puffing up while they cook.
05 -
Pop the tray in the oven and cook for 12 to 15 minutes, or until they turn crispy and golden. Let them cool fully before packing them away or digging in.
